Transaction 3caa661a9f01bf269080c30565f571baf98b05262af4af2e6dd3fbff9f2e9c1b
1 Input
1 Output
-
3caa661a9f01bf269080c30565f571baf98b05262af4af2e6dd3fbff9f2e9c1b:0
- value
- 912670
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8248ee17aba4ebbcf961f0db1d87ba429aa528c
- address
- bc1qmqjgact6hf8thnukruxmrkrm5s56555vt5zzah